Output d76067206594ea61da90223b589d911b3c0793c2d6702efc992edef0f4b86d1a:0

value
308844340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ed27e714f1231ffb7df9f08724e6fcb7934b483 OP_EQUAL
address
MF5w6mRMNc7Lmy815ta5YjXpEAQ42qS8ea
transaction
d76067206594ea61da90223b589d911b3c0793c2d6702efc992edef0f4b86d1a
spent
true